Amazon ec2 Can';t不要在EC2上使用端口80和8080以外的端口

Amazon ec2 Can';t不要在EC2上使用端口80和8080以外的端口,amazon-ec2,Amazon Ec2,我在AWS的EC2上有一个Ubuntu13实例 在这种情况下,在nginx上安装了2个应用程序,端口分别为80和8080。我还让Tomcat在8888端口上运行 我用AWS控制台->安全组->入站->自定义TCP规则写了这些端口 直到昨晚,它在所有端口80、8080、8888上都运行良好 但是今天早上,我无法连接到8888端口。我不会在Instance和AWS的控制台上更改任何东西。我验证了wget localhost:8888工作正常 你有办法解决这个问题吗 提前谢谢你 田,telent 88

我在AWS的EC2上有一个Ubuntu13实例

在这种情况下,在nginx上安装了2个应用程序,端口分别为80和8080。我还让Tomcat在8888端口上运行

我用AWS控制台->安全组->入站->自定义TCP规则写了这些端口

直到昨晚,它在所有端口80、8080、8888上都运行良好

但是今天早上,我无法连接到8888端口。我不会在Instance和AWS的控制台上更改任何东西。我验证了wget localhost:8888工作正常

你有办法解决这个问题吗

提前谢谢你


田,

telent 8888说了什么?从您试图连接的工作站运行此命令。您的tomcat服务器是绑定到127.0.0.1还是本地主机?很可能您的tomcat服务器不允许外部连接。不确定为什么它以前工作过,但现在不工作了,听起来好像有人为干预使它不工作。我认为这是EC2的问题。因为当我将Tomcat的端口更改为8080,nginx更改为8888时,Tomcat工作,但nginx不工作。telnet IP:8888,telnet IP:80,telnet:8080不工作,但是ssh-i amazon.pemubuntu@IP工作顺利。